我正在开发 Android 应用程序,该应用程序在 Facebook、Google 和电子邮件/密码等 Firebase 的帮助下使用多重身份验证。每个身份验证都以不同的方式运作良好。
但是,当我使用 google 登录然后注销时,以及稍后当我使用 facebook 使用相同的电子邮件 ID 进行登录时..
It says.
com.google.firebase.auth.FirebaseAuthUserCollisionException:一个
已存在具有相同电子邮件地址但不同的帐户
登录凭据。使用与此关联的提供商登录
电子邮件地址。
我想要做的就是,当用户尝试使用相同的电子邮件 ID 通过不同的身份验证提供商登录时合并帐户。
是的,有什么办法可以通过使用 firebase 来处理这个问题。
请帮忙。
只需在这里更改它..仅此而已..不客气
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)